Hi all, It is nortel option 11c release 4.0 system.
I have two route in the pbx as given below

Rout1, Type DID
Route2, Type DID

now we wants that if some user dial out from route1 the master number of that route must be shown as dialout CLID (e.g. 111222333).
But if the same user dialout from Route2 the DID number must be shown as dialout CLID (4534xxx).

Can somebody please help or point some guide for same?
 
One possible solution using digital sets would be to have the main SCR key on a digital set to have CLID entry "0" set to DIDN = YES so that outgoing DID calls showing the extension number are sent out.

Set up another SCR key with a different extension number and this doesn't have to be the same extension number as the previous one, but set a different CLID entry against it so that DID calls aren't sent out with DIDN = NO.

Thanks for the response but customer does not wants to use two keys. They are insisting that key 0 must be use for dialout from both roue with different CLI for both route.
 
Perhaps you could try using a Phantom DN with a different CLID table entry set to the PABX single outgoing number and set the call forward to just use the trunks ACOD. All the users need to do is to dial the extension number for the Phantom DN, followed by the number they need.

There might be implications with dial through fraud using this method, so I would consider placing outgoing restrictions.

I'm not even certain that this method would work.

First of all are these PRI's ? Is BARS selecting the route or are you dialing the ACOD? Why the 2 routes?
 
We are dialing out using ACOD. There are two different PRIs from different vendor that why we made two route. Any more help?
 
I would ask the vendor who supply's the PRI for the route that you want to send out the Company # to do that for you. They can block the DID # from being sent and tag each call with the main #. I have seen this done. There is no way to do this in the PBX, a Key can have only 1 CLID entry.
